How Fitness and Nutrition Actually Work
Fitness and Nutrition are foundational to overall wellness. Physical activity—whether structured exercise or daily movement—supports cardiovascular health, strength, and metabolic efficiency. Meanwhile, balanced nutrition fuels these efforts with essential vitamins, minerals, proteins, and healthy fats. Together, they influence energy levels, recovery, and resilience.
Understanding these components helps users make informed choices. Movement doesn’t have to mean intense workouts; even moderate activity integrated into daily life boosts circulation, mood, and endurance. Nutrition, too, isn’t just calorie counting—it’s about quality, timing, and personalized needs that vary by age, lifestyle, and goals.

How much exercise do adults really need?
The general recommendation includes at least 150 minutes of moderate aerobic activity weekly, plus strength training twice a week. This balance supports long-term health without overwhelming routine.
Can nutrition really impact mood and focus?
Emerging research shows clear links between diet quality and cognitive function. Diets rich in whole foods, fiber, and essential nutrients contribute to sustained energy and mental clarity.
Is it possible to maintain fitness without intense training?
Absolutely. Consistency matters more than intensity. Even daily walks, household activity, or brief stretching improve cardiovascular health and metabolic function over time.
Do supplements replace balanced meals?
Supplements may help address deficiencies but are not substitutes for nutrient-dense whole foods. Whole food nutrition provides complex benefits that isolated supplements cannot replicate.
What role does hydration play in fitness and nutrition?
Staying properly hydrated enhances exercise performance, regulates body temperature, and supports digestion and nutrient absorption—key pillars of effective wellness.

Opportunities and Considerations
Fitness and Nutrition offer meaningful benefits: improved stamina, better sleep, disease risk reduction, and increased confidence. However, expectations must align with realistic goals. Success depends on sustainability, not short-term extremes. Individual variation in metabolism, genetics, and lifestyle demands personalized approaches—discipline works best when adaptable.
Common Misconceptions About Fitness and Nutrition
-
“Cardio is the only path to weight loss.”
Reality: Combining cardio with strength training accelerates fat loss, builds muscle, and boosts longevity. -
“All fats are unhealthy.”
Fact: Unsaturated fats support brain function and hormone balance; saturated and trans fats should be limited. -
“You need special diets to succeed.”
In fact, a flexible, nutrient-rich eating pattern tailored to individual needs is more sustainable and healthier long-term.
